SHIPPING RUMOURS.
RATES AND AMALGAMATIONS. {By Cable.—Press Association.—Copyright.) (Australian and N.Z. Cable Association.) (Received September 6th, 12.5 a.m.) LONDON, September 4. P. and 0. shares are quoted at £440. , Shipping shares generally are strong #nd active owing to a rumour of a change being imminent in the Government's policy regal ding rates; also a revival of the rumours that tho P. and 0, Company is about to amalgamate with the Cunard Company and Uewrs F urn ess, "Withy, and Co.
